Jimi DePriest (b. 1997) is an emerging mixed media bio/techno artist and cultural anthropologist currently living and working on unceeded Whadjuk Noongar Boodjar, always will be. Jimi’s creative practice is influenced by their research interests in composing Marxist and anti-imperialist analyses of automation and weapons technologies. The intersection of technoscience and political critique which defines Jimi’s arts practice has enabled them to develop practical experience across critical theory, wet lab media, robotics, electronics, digital media, and film. They seek to continue expanding their analytical and technical capacities to produce increasingly complex and transgressive bio/techno media installations while broadening the conceptual scope of their work to touch more explicitly on themes of cyber-feminism and psychoanalysis.
